![]() Okay, recieved my Reef-Roids last night and fed the tank for the first time. I just used a small little chunk of roids in the 20g.. turned the pumps off, and target fed a few areas (frogspawn, hammer, rics, zoos, anemone, clam) Just to see the reactions.... then I dumped the rest of the batch in the tank and turned pumps back on. My observations after the first feed:
Frogspawn - Slimed up, then shrunk up about half hour later (eating?) Hammer - No reaction. [perhaps I didn't get enough roids onto it] Rics - My blue ric's started puffing up in a couple areas. My green Yuma did not appear to have a reaction. Zoos - Not all zoos ate this stuff, but my bullseyes closed up completely around the food.. pretty neat. Anemone - As soon as the roids hit the tank you could see the tentacles go all crazy trying to catch the food, but when I spot fed... the thing just tried closing right up .. again, pretty neat. Clam - You could tell it tried to eat some, it closed up and re-expanded. My fish went pretty nuts as well... clowns were just swimming all over trying to suck it all up... my watchman goby went bonkers, trying to steal my pipette I used out of my hands.. he literally stuck his whole mouth over the syringe haha. All in all, not too bad for the first feed! I was pretty impressed with the reactions, so long-term use should be pretty interesting. Looking forward to seeing long-term results ![]()
